引言

在数字经济快速发展的今天,加密货币的兴起为全球金融生态带来了深远的变革。不仅引发了人们对虚拟资产的关注,而且还催生了一系列新技术的发展。其中,多方计算(MPC)作为一项重要的加密技术,正在逐渐成为解决加密货币和区块链技术中的隐私和安全问题的关键手段。

本文将详细探讨多方计算在加密货币应用中的重要性、基本原理以及实际案例,并讨论一些相关的问题,以期为想要深入了解这一技术的读者提供全面的视角。

多方计算的基本概念

多方计算(Multi-party computation, MPC)是一种高级的加密协议,允许多个参与者共同计算一个函数,同时保持各自输入的私密性。这意味着,即便是计算的参与者也不会知道其他参与者的具体输入信息。MPC广泛应用于需要在保护隐私的前提下共享和计算数据的场景,比如金融数据处理、数据库查询等。

在加密货币领域,MPC能有效解决由于共享信息导致的隐私风险。例如,在一个区块链网络中,用户在交易时需要保护其账号余额和交易历史。而通过MPC技术,这些信息可以在不透露实际数据的情况下安全计算和验证交易的有效性。

多方计算在加密货币中的重要性

随着加密货币的普及,安全性和隐私性变得越来越重要。多方计算为这个问题提供了一个行之有效的解决方案。以下是它在加密货币中的重要性:

  • 隐私保护:MPC允许多个用户参与同一计算,而不必公开自己的输入数据。这种隐私保护机制尤其在涉及敏感金融数据时显得尤为重要。
  • 防止欺诈和篡改:通过MPC技术,用户的输入信息遭到保护,从而减少了恶意攻击和欺诈的可能性。这有助于增强整体网络的安全性。
  • 提高效率:由于多方计算允许分布式计算,能够显著提高运算效率,尤其是在处理需要高频次计算的情况下,能有效减轻单一节点的负担。
  • 增强透明度:MPC技术可以确保各方共同参与计算,提高审计的透明性。这对于构建用户对加密货币系统的信任至关重要。

多方计算的基本原理

了解多方计算的原理,有助于更好地理解其在加密货币中的应用。MPC的核心是通过算法将输入数据加密并进行分割,让各参与方各自持有一部分信息,而无须完全了解其他参与者的信息。

最常用的MPC协议之一是“秘密分享”,此协议的主要概念是将输入数据分割成若干份,只有在满足一定条件(如至少k个参与者联合作为输入)时,才能重构出原始数据。

以下是MPC基本的操作过程:

  1. 输入分割:每个参与者将其输入数据分割成若干部分,并将其分发给其他参与者。
  2. 局部计算:每个参与者在其接收到的分片上进行计算,生成局部结果。
  3. 结果合并:通过交换局部结果,参与者最终合并这些结果并完成计算。

这一过程确保了个体输入的私密性,同时实现了协作计算,有效避免了信息泄露的风险。

实例分析:多方计算在金融领域的应用

多方计算在加密货币和金融领域的应用相当广泛。下面我们将举一个具体案例,探讨其在数据共享和隐私保护中的实用性。

考虑从事贷款审批的金融机构。通过MPC技术,多家银行虽然在进行信用评估时需要用户的个人信息,但又不希望各自分享这些信息的细节。利用MPC,银行可以共同计算用户的信用评分,而不需要直接披露其具体的财务数据。

在这个过程中,各银行可以将客户的相关数据(如借款记录、违约记录等)进行分片,每家银行各持一部分,同时在保护隐私的基础上进行计算。这不仅提高了信贷审批的效率,也降低了由于信息共享所导致的隐私泄露风险。

关键词1:加密货币的隐私保护

在加密货币的世界中,隐私保护是用户最关心的问题之一。虽然区块链技术提供了交易公开透明的优势,但这也导致了用户交易历史的透明度,使得用户的隐私信息可能被轻易识别。MPC技术通过其特殊的计算模式,可以在不揭示个人数据的情况下,仍然保证交易的真实性和有效性。

例如,在使用传统交易方式时,参与者需要提交自己的钱包地址和交易信息,而这些数据可以被第三方轻易获取。而利用MPC,这些信息可以通过加密处理进行计算,将隐私保护提升到了一个新的水平。对用户而言,这增加了信任感,促进了加密货币的使用。

关键词2:多方计算的未来展望

面对区块链世界的快速发展,MPC技术代表了一种具备未来潜力的隐私保护解决方案。随着越来越多的公司和机构意识到数据隐私的重要性,MPC技术将会有更广泛的应用场景。在未来,我们或许可以看到MPC与其他先进技术的结合,如人工智能、物联网等。

此外,随着区块链技术的发展,MPC可能会被更多区块链项目所采纳,成为未来加密货币新标准的一部分。通过利用MPC技术,交易将变得更加安全,同时也将促进用户更多地参与到加密货币经济中。

关键词3:区块链技术与多方计算结合的潜力

区块链技术的去中心化特性与多方计算的隐私保护相结合,有潜力在各个行业创造全新的数据处理方式。MPC不仅能够改善区块链交易的隐私性,还能够提升区块链应用场景的灵活性。

例如,在可持续金融领域,参与者可以利用MPC共同计算碳排放数据,以便确定哪些企业可以获得减排信用,而无须披露其具体的业务内幕。这不仅提升了计算效率,还为不同企业之间的合作提供了新的可能性。

关键词4:多方计算的技术挑战与解决方案

尽管多方计算在加密货币中展现了巨大的潜力,但它也面临着许多技术挑战。首先是计算复杂度。MPC协议的复杂性可能会导致计算速度较慢,而加密货币网络通常需要快速响应。因此在协议设计时,需要算法以提高效率。

其次是参与方的信任问题。在许多情况下,MPC的安全性依赖于参与者的诚实与合规。一些协议设计需要考虑如何在不引入中心化信任的情况下构建参与者之间的保证机制。

为解决这些挑战,研究人员和开发者正在探索各种协议的改进方案,新的算法和更高效的加密方法将会是未来发展的重要方向。

相关问题探索

1. 多方计算如何提升区块链技术的安全性?

多方计算通过在多个参与者之间分散计算任务与数据,从而降低因单点故障而导致的安全风险。每个参与者都只持有一部分信息,从而即便其中某个参与者被攻破,恶意方也无法获取完整数据。此外,MPC协议通常涵盖了一系列加密技术,能够进一步增强数据传输过程中的安全性。

因此,多方计算的引入,为区块链生态系统中的数据安全性提升开辟了新的可能。特别是在金融领域以及医疗数据管理等行业,MPC显得尤为重要。各方可以通过协作计算完成复杂任务,而无需担心信息泄露或被恶意窃取。

2. 加密货币中使用多方计算的实际案例有哪些?

在加密货币及其相关领域中,已经有多个成功的多方计算应用案例。例如,某些DeFi(去中心化金融)平台利用MPC来进行用户身份认证和交易验证。通过将用户的敏感信息分割并加密存储,各参与者可以安全地验证身份并执行交易,而无需担心隐私泄露。

此外,一些跨国机构在处理国际支付时,也采取多方计算技术,以确保在交易过程中各方信息的隐私性。通过这种方式,各国的金融机构能够有效合作,同时保护客户的隐私数据。

3. 多方计算在加密货币的未来发展趋势如何?

展望未来,多方计算在加密货币中将会有更为广阔的应用前景。从数据隐私保护、提升交易安全性到增强区块链技术的整体效率,MPC都将成为许多新兴技术的重要组成部分。随着越来越多的区块链项目寻求提高用户隐私和数据安全性,MPC的需求将会显著增长。

此外,随着相关标准和规范的建立,MPC也将能在法律与合规的框架内更广泛地应用,为金融科技等行业带来资源共享与协作的新机遇。整体来看,未来MPC在加密货币生态中的整合,将进一步推动区块链技术的发展和成熟。

4. 多方计算的技术瓶颈与研究方向是什么?

尽管多方计算技术已经相当成熟,但依然存在不少挑战和技术瓶颈。主要问题包括计算性能的提升、协议的最以及参与者信誉问题等。当前的多方计算协议,往往导致计算负担较重,每次计算都需要设施较大的资源来完成,这对资源有限的小型企业或项目构成挑战。

因此,当前的研究方向主要集中于算法,力求降低计算复杂度,并在保证安全性的前提下提高计算速度和效率。此外,研究者正在探索如何在参与者中加强信任机制,以确保即便在参与者中存在潜在的恶意行为时,MPC也能保持其功能。

通过持续的研究和技术创新,多方计算将在加密货币及其他相关领域,实现更高的安全性和隐私保护,助力数字经济的发展。

结语

多方计算为加密货币带来了前所未有的隐私保护和安全性,成为许多用户和金融机构在数字时代的重要工具。随着技术的持续发展,MPC在加密货币领域的应用将会更加广泛和深入。希望本文能为读者们提供有关多方计算的基本概念以及在加密货币中的重要应用与展望,助您在数字金融领域中得到更全面的理解。